Coastal Resilience Engineering

Definition

Property value implications refer to the effects that coastal engineering projects, such as hard engineering approaches, can have on the market value of nearby properties. These implications often arise from changes in accessibility, aesthetics, and perceived safety due to the modifications made to the coastal environment. Understanding these implications is crucial as they influence not just individual property values but also broader economic stability in coastal regions.

5 Must Know Facts For Your Next Test

  1. Hard engineering projects can lead to increased property values in areas perceived as safer from flooding and erosion.
  2. Conversely, properties near hard engineering structures may experience decreased values if residents perceive negative impacts like visual obstructions or changes in beach access.
  3. The effectiveness of hard engineering solutions can directly impact local real estate markets, influencing decisions by potential buyers and investors.
  4. Long-term maintenance and effectiveness of hard engineering projects are vital to sustaining positive property value implications over time.
  5. Community sentiment towards hard engineering projects plays a significant role in determining property value outcomes, as public opinion can affect market demand.

Review Questions

  • How do hard engineering approaches potentially influence property values in coastal areas?
    • Hard engineering approaches can significantly influence property values by enhancing perceptions of safety and reducing risks associated with flooding and erosion. For example, the construction of sea walls may make adjacent properties more desirable, leading to increased market value. However, if these structures obstruct views or access to the beach, they may negatively affect property values instead. Thus, the overall impact on property values depends on how residents perceive these changes and their effectiveness in protecting coastal areas.
  • Discuss the trade-offs between property values and the implementation of hard engineering solutions in coastal management.
    • When implementing hard engineering solutions for coastal management, trade-offs often arise between protecting properties from environmental threats and maintaining aesthetic and recreational value. While such structures can safeguard homes and businesses from flooding, they may also disrupt natural landscapes or public access to beaches. As a result, some properties may experience an increase in value due to enhanced safety, while others may see a decline because of perceived negative impacts. Balancing these factors is crucial for community acceptance and long-term economic viability.
  • Evaluate the long-term economic implications of hard engineering projects on local communities concerning property values.
    • The long-term economic implications of hard engineering projects on local communities are complex and multifaceted. Successful hard engineering can stabilize property values by preventing erosion and flood damage, thereby fostering confidence among homeowners and investors. However, if these projects fail to maintain their protective benefits or lead to adverse environmental impacts, they could result in declining property values and economic instability in coastal regions. Therefore, continuous assessment of both the effectiveness of these structures and their impact on community sentiment is essential for sustaining healthy real estate markets and local economies.
